Book Overview

On June 28, 1987, four Dallas-based Christian leaders were killed in an airplane crash as they were returning from a Focus on the Family retreat in Montana: George L. Clark, chairman of the board and... This description may be from another edition of this product.

A great help while mourning

I just finished reading this book and am so grateful at all the chapters I was able to relate to. Even though our circumstances were very different (my husband was killed while working as a Sheriff's Deputy and we were married only 2 years), I found so many similarities in my life and hers. She allows the reader to feel and think whatever is in their heart without rushing them through the process. The book reminds us that hope and peace is to be found only in Christ and His sustaining love.
